#515763 color RGB value is (81,87,99). #515763 color name is Custom Color color.
#515763 hex color red value is 81, green value is 87 and the blue value of its RGB is 99. Cylindrical-coordinate representations (also known as HSL) of color #515763 hue: 0.61, saturation: 0.10 and the lightness value of 515763 is 0.35.
The process color (four color CMYK) of #515763 color hex is 0.18, 0.12, 0.00, 0.61. Web safe color of #515763 is #666666. Color #515763 contains mainly BLUE color.

About #515763 Custom Color
#515763 (Custom Color) is a blue-based color with RGB values of 81, 87, 99. This color belongs to the blue color family and can be used in various design applications including web design, graphic design, interior design, and branding projects.
When working with #515763, designers often pair it with complementary colors to create visual contrast, or use analogous colors for a more harmonious palette. The shades (darker versions) and tints (lighter versions) shown above provide a monochromatic color scheme that works well for creating depth and hierarchy in designs.
For web development, #515763 can be implemented using various CSS color formats including hexadecimal (#515763), RGB (rgb(81, 87, 99)), HSL (hsl(220, 10%, 35%)), or CMYK for print projects. The web-safe equivalent of this color is #666666, which ensures consistent display across older browsers and devices.
